System Validation Engineer - Intern Position

Job Description

In this position, you will be working as a member of the Product Collaboration and Systems
Division PCSD responsible for ensuring the commercial and collaborative server platforms meet
our customer qualify expectations. You will be a member of the platform validation in charge of
the test strategy, test planning, execution and reporting. The responsibilities in this position will be
validation focused. This team verify the integration of server components across various
configurations of CPU, Memory, PCH, I/O devices and Operating Systems. Additionally, validation
will include simulation of customer environments with application workloads, use cases, and
platform level stress. Additional focus on validation with a customer focus including understanding
of customer application workloads, user scenarios, and system level performance. Some of the
activities you will be participate on include:

- Planning, developing and executing validation tasks


- Investigating and adapting appropriate existing validation tools
- Planning, developing and executing code and tools to keep metrics automatically updated.
- Planning, developing and executing Systems Engineering Best Practices.
- Designing, developing and debugging Validation Tools and SW.
- Participating in Product planning and release meetings and decisions.
- Engaging with various internal cross-team validation organizations.

Security Researcher - Intern


Job Description
Trustworthy Execution, Anti-Malware, Cryptography, and Privacy are key elements
of the security assurance on today's Intel products. A Security Researcher validates
systems in order to prevent, detect and mitigate possible vulnerabilities, and this
task requires great technical knowledge, expertise, attention to detail and out of
the box thinking. The Security Center of Excellence is responsible for security
assurance across a wide set of Intel products. A typical day as a Security
Researcher Intern might include: Meet with your team to discuss possible attack
scenarios Develop a Linux shell script to confirm a theoretical attack Explore new
paths to known attacks as well as new possible venues of intrusion Develop state
of the art automated security testing tools Keep up to date on the latest system
exploits and advanced threats.
